Abstract

This study shows that monitoring frequency changes of the EMG signals may enable therapists to quantify the fatigue changes of individual muscles during the trunk holding test. The higher fatigue rate shown in the multifidus muscle compared with the iliocostalis lumborum muscle may be due to the higher activity level of the multifidus muscle during te trunk holding contraction. This greater activity of the multifidus muscle during the contraction might be explained by the functional differences between these two muscles.
